What we do:

As a recognized leader in providing Private Markets Solutions to clients across the globe we manage approximately $120.2 billion in discretionary assets and have oversight of an additional $782.9 in non-discretionary assets as of December 31, 2023.

The Opportunity:

Hamilton Lane is a leading data-driven private markets firm that leverages technology to make data work for our business. We are seeking a talented and motivated Senior Associate/VP of Data Intelligence to join our growing team. If you are passionate about transforming data into meaningful business solutions and possess expertise in Azure, SQL, Power BI, and data warehousing we want to hear from you.

Your responsibilities will be to:

  • Lead Business Intelligence efforts in Power BI to transform business operations and analytics.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to understand requirements and ensure data accuracy and consistency.
  • Build efficient data models in Power BI that support robust reporting and analytics.
  • Perform data analysis and validation to ensure accuracy and consistency.
  • Provide ongoing support and maintenance for Power BI reports and dashboards, including troubleshooting and resolving issues as they arise.
  • Train business users on how to leverage the data provided in our data warehouse, data lake, and data marts.
  • Implement and enforce data governance policies to ensure data integrity and security.
  • Communicate complex techn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ders in a clear and concise manner.

Your background will include: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Data Analytics, Computer Science, Statistics, Mathematics, or equivalent work experience.
  • 6-10+ years of experience in a data role (Data Analyst, Data Engineer, Analytics Engineer, BI Engineer).
  • 3-5+ years of experience with Power BI, including DAX and Power Query.
  • 3+ years of experience with SQL or other query languages.
  • 2+ years working with Azure, AWS, or GCP.
  • Intermediate/Advanced SQL skills for data manipulation and orchestration.
  • Experience with data warehousing techniques and star schema data modeling.
  • Experience with cloud-based data solutions, Snowflake or Azure is a plus.
  • Experience implementing and maintaining semantic data models.
  • Experience utilizing SDLC and engineering best practices.
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Strong communication and collaboration skills.

Nice to have:

  • Experience working in financial services, Private Markets is a plus.
  • Experience with Python, R, or other scripting language.
  • Experience working with Data Engineers.
